Moreover, the manual contains the only correct procedure for bleeding the combined braking system (if your variant has ABS). Unlike a standard dual-brake bleed, the Gixxer’s system requires a specific order: rear caliper first, then the front left caliper, then the front right. Do it wrong, and you’ll trap air in the ABS pump, leading to a spongy lever that no amount of pumping will fix.
